MySQL安装:无需Setup的简易指南

mysql没有setup安装选项

时间:2025-06-30 09:28


MySQL:无需Setup安装选项的灵活与强大 在数据库管理系统的世界里,MySQL以其开源、高效、灵活的特点,成为了众多开发者和企业的首选

    然而,对于初次接触MySQL的用户来说,可能会发现MySQL并没有像某些软件那样提供一个直观的“setup”安装选项

    这一发现可能会让人感到困惑甚至失望,但深入了解后你会发现,这恰恰体现了MySQL在设计上的深思熟虑和强大功能

     一、MySQL的安装方式:多样而灵活 MySQL的安装并不依赖于一个单一的“setup”程序,而是提供了多种安装方式,以适应不同用户的需求和环境

    这些安装方式包括但不限于: 1.安装包安装: - 对于Windows用户,MySQL提供了MSI安装包,用户可以通过双击安装包并按照向导提示完成安装

    虽然这个过程没有“setup”标签,但安装向导的步骤清晰明了,易于操作

     - 对于Linux用户,MySQL提供了RPM或DEB格式的包,可以通过系统的包管理器(如yum、apt)进行安装,这种方式更加符合Linux用户的操作习惯

     2.源码编译安装: - 对于需要定制MySQL功能的用户,源码编译安装是一个不错的选择

    通过下载MySQL的源码包,并根据自己的需求进行配置和编译,用户可以获得完全定制化的MySQL版本

    这种方式虽然相对复杂,但提供了极大的灵活性

     3.Docker容器安装: - 随着容器技术的兴起,MySQL也提供了Docker镜像

    用户可以通过Docker来快速部署MySQL实例,无需关心底层的安装和配置细节

    这种方式非常适合于需要快速部署和横向扩展的场景

     4.云数据库服务: - 许多云服务提供商(如阿里云、腾讯云、AWS等)都提供了MySQL数据库服务

    用户只需在云平台上选择相应的配置和规格,即可快速获得一个可用的MySQL实例

    这种方式大大降低了数据库运维的复杂度,使得用户可以更加专注于业务逻辑的开发

     二、MySQL无“setup”安装选项的深层原因 MySQL之所以没有提供一个统一的“setup”安装选项,背后有着深层次的考虑: 1.跨平台兼容性: - MySQL需要在多种操作系统上运行,包括Windows、Linux、macOS等

    每个操作系统都有其独特的安装和配置方式,因此很难通过一个统一的“setup”程序来满足所有平台的需求

     2.灵活性与可定制性: - MySQL是一个高度可定制的数据库管理系统

    用户可以根据自己的需求选择不同的存储引擎、字符集、优化选项等

    这种灵活性要求安装过程能够提供足够的配置选项,而一个单一的“setup”程序往往难以做到这一点

     3.安全性与稳定性: - 在安装过程中,用户可能需要设置数据库管理员密码、配置网络连接等敏感信息

    通过一个更加细致和可控的安装过程,MySQL可以确保这些信息的安全性,并减少因误操作而导致的稳定性问题

     4.社区支持与文档: - MySQL拥有一个庞大的社区和丰富的文档资源

    用户可以通过社区论坛、官方文档等途径获取安装和配置方面的帮助

    这种社区支持的方式比单一的“setup”程序更加灵活和高效

     三、MySQL安装过程中的注意事项 虽然MySQL没有提供一个直观的“setup”安装选项,但用户在安装过程中仍需注意以下几点: 1.选择合适的安装版本: - 根据自己的操作系统和硬件环境选择合适的MySQL版本

    对于生产环境,建议选择稳定版(GA版),以确保数据库的可靠性和稳定性

     2.仔细阅读安装文档: - 在安装之前,仔细阅读MySQL的官方安装文档或社区提供的教程

    这些文档通常会提供详细的安装步骤和注意事项,有助于用户顺利完成安装

     3.配置数据库管理员密码: - 在安装过程中,务必设置一个强密码来保护数据库管理员账户

    同时,定期更换密码并限制管理员账户的访问权限,以提高数据库的安全性

     4.优化数据库性能: - 根据自己的业务需求和数据量大小,对MySQL进行性能优化

    这包括调整内存分配、优化查询语句、使用索引等

    通过合理的性能优化,可以显著提高MySQL的响应速度和吞吐量

     5.定期备份数据: - 数据是数据库的核心资产

    在安装完成后,务必定期备份数据库数据,以防止数据丢失或损坏

    可以选择使用MySQL自带的备份工具(如mysqldump)或第三方备份软件来实现数据的定期备份

     四、结语 综上所述,MySQL没有提供一个直观的“setup”安装选项,并不意味着其安装过程复杂或难以操作

    相反,MySQL提供了多种灵活而强大的安装方式,以适应不同用户的需求和环境

    通过仔细阅读安装文档、选择合适的安装版本、配置强密码、优化数据库性能以及定期备份数据等措施,用户可以顺利完成MySQL的安装和配置工作,并享受到MySQL带来的高效、稳定和可靠的数据库服务

    在未来的数据库管理旅程中,MySQL将继续以其开源、灵活和强大的特点,成为广大开发者和企业的得力助手